The Singapura ("Singapore" in Malay) is the smallest recognised cat breed β€” typically just 2–3 kg even as adults. Big-eared, big-eyed, with a unique ticked sepia coat. Affectionate and playful.

Temperament

Curious, affectionate, social, "people cats" who love laps.

Exercise needs

High activity for size.

Grooming

Very short coat, weekly brush is plenty.

Common health issues

Pyruvate kinase deficiency (DNA test). Generally hardy.

πŸ‘ Best for

Apartment dwellers, families, multi-pet homes.

πŸ‘Ž Not best for

Cold homes β€” small body, thin coat.
